What Is a Post-Bariatric Weight Loss Makeover?
A body makeover after weight loss is a personalized combination of procedures tailored to your needs. The goal is to:
-
Remove excess skin that causes chafing, discomfort, or hygiene issues
-
Improve body proportions and contours
-
Restore confidence and mobility
-
Help you enjoy your weight-loss results to the fullest
Procedures may include:
-
Tummy Tuck (Abdominoplasty) – removes loose skin and tightens abdominal muscles
-
Lower Body Lift – addresses the abdomen, flanks, back, and buttocks
-
Breast Lift or Augmentation – restores shape and volume
-
Arm Lift (Brachioplasty) – tightens sagging skin on the upper arms
-
Thigh Lift – reshapes and tightens the inner and outer thighs

Thigh Lift: Restoring Leg Shape & Contour
A Thigh Lift (Thighplasty) is often part of post-bariatric surgery. After major weight loss, the inner thighs especially can be left with excess hanging skin that no amount of diet or exercise can correct.
During a thigh lift, our surgeons:
-
Make discreet incisions along the groin crease or inner thigh
-
Remove loose, excess skin
-
Sculpt and contour the thighs by excising tissue and tightening skin
-
May combine liposuction for stubborn fat deposits
The result is firmer, smoother, and more toned thighs that no longer rub or cause discomfort.
Recovery & Healing
-
-
Hospital Stay: Some patients may require an overnight stay depending on extent of surgery
-
Downtime: 2–4 weeks before returning to work (varies with procedures performed)
-
Compression Garments: Worn for several weeks to reduce swelling and aid healing
-
Activity: Walking is encouraged early; strenuous activity avoided for 6–8 weeks
-
Scars: Incisions are placed strategically and fade significantly over time with proper care

Ideal Candidates
-
You may be a candidate for a post-bariatric makeover and thigh lift if you:
-
Have lost a significant amount of weight (50–100+ lbs)
-
Struggle with hanging skin on your abdomen, thighs, arms, or back
-
Are at a stable weight for at least 6 months
-
Are in good health and a non-smoker
-
Have realistic expectations about scars and results

The Procedure
-
-
-
Anesthesia: General anesthesia for comfort
-
Duration: 3–6 hours depending on the number of procedures combined
-
Techniques Used: May involve extended incisions for large skin removal, often placed in natural body folds for concealment
-
Customization: Each makeover is tailored—some patients undergo surgery in stages depending on the areas to be treated
